The Role
To support our progress, we are currently recruiting for a Senior Facade Engineer to come and join our team. This role can be based in London or Leicestershire.
Specific Responsibilities
- Develop and manage a team to deliver technical designs using Ibstock products to customers for all product lines, meeting required specifications and regulatory requirements
- Manage and develop a team to provide 2nd line support, handling customer technical enquiries on projects
- Manage the team to liaise and build relationships with customers in planning and execution stages of projects to plan, agree and execute delivery packages with schedules
- Define, agree and implement standard systems for design and storage of technical information with appropriate levels of access for colleagues
- Define, agree, implement and maintain sets of standard CAD details and BIM Objects for all products and systems, ensuring appropriate access for colleagues and customers
- Support the team in providing configurators, panelisation and quotation tools to enable rapid and accurate project schedules and quotes
- Ensure the Team are have the suitable skills, knowledge, experience and behaviour to complete their work in line with BSA, maintain a log of this and where required ensure appropriate development is planned and carried out
- Software and hardware management for design and technical team- ensuring that the correct hardware and software are used to complete the teams objectives
- Recommend upgrades for licences. Maintain record of software & hardware against personnel

Qualifications & Experience
Essential
- Degree qualified in an engineering construction discipline or appropriate equivalent experience
- 5 years’ experience within façade engineering
- Experience and ability to manage people and teams
- Ability to prioritise a sizeable workload whilst delivering on key commitments
- Strong leadership, communication and interpersonal skills
